We started off with the toasted raviolis (3 cheese & 3 meat). They were very large. Needed a tiny bit of salt but overall were really good. Garlic bread is a MUST, it was amazing in the meat gravy (sauce that came with the raviolis) We got casseruola and let me tell you. It was cheesy, it was creamy, it was bacony. 9/10 to me. Only thing that coulda make it better was little more chicken but I won't complain about that. It was great. We also got chicken Marsala and that was not as great. It wasn't bad at all but it lacked the creamy flavor you're supposed to get from the Marsala. Sauce was a little bland but overall not bad. We didn't eat as much of this one and ended up splitting the casseruola. 5/10 on the marsala. Lastly we finished with mocha cake and it was decent. Essentially was just a small brownie in a small cup with one scoop of ice cream on it. Wasn't overly sweet but if you're looking for sweet treat I'd prolly get it again. Now the best part. Stephanie was our waitress and she was constantly checking on us making sure we got what we ordered and refilling our drinks (the glasses are small so we had her running). Overall ambiance wasn't bad. It's a nicer place and we weren't expecting it to be that nice. Definitely weren't dressed for the occasion.
